About

Sean Michael Shultz is a business attorney with 22 years of legal experience, practicing at Saidis, Shultz & Fisher LLC in Mechanicsburg, PA. He attended Pennsylvania State University, Dickinson School of Law Juris Doctor and Pennsylvania State University Bachelor of Arts. He has been admitted to the Pennsylvania Bar since 2003. His practice encompasses business, estate planning, family, land use and zoning, and real estate,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
